If you're starting to panic about your potential commute hell during this summer's London Olympics a new web film, through Publicis London and Crossroads Films for Irish Tourism, probably won't help settle the anxiety. But it will offer a way out!
The two-minute YouTube film, directed by Pat Holden, pits two friends against each other in a race to two very different destinations. Can one, ‘Yer Man’, fly to Ireland and have a pint of stout before his mate, ‘Office Boy’, commutes to his London office and enjoys a latte? It's all revealed above.
Narrated by actor Chris O'Dowd, who also makes a cameo appearance, the clip follows the two men on their contrasting journeys and invites users to select one of two options for the chance to win a gaelic getaway.
